I've a situation where both my OpenVPN server and client are in routed LAN's (multiple VLAN's at each site).
Server is running OpenVPNAS 2.1 (Site A) and the client is running on Linux box (Site B).
Site A have 10.5.7.0/24 + 10.5.8.0/24 as routed VLAN's besides the server VLAN (10.5.5.0/24)
Server itself is on 10.5.5.10 with default gateway points to 10.5.5.1 and static route to 10.5.X.0/24 points at 10.5.5.251
Site B have 10.35.1.0/24 + 10.35.2.0/24 as routed VLAN's besides the client VLAN (10.35.0.0/24)
Client itself is on 10.35.0.223 with default gateway points to 10.35.0.253 and static route to 10.35.X.0/24 points at 10.35.0.251
Now, publishing the server side subnets was easy using the web UI, and the client (and other clients on subnet 10.35.0.0/24) are able to access all SITE A systems.
BUT, the server never recognize SITE B additional VLAN's and I'm unable to know why the push command in the client configuration file isn't working!!!
Could anyone help?
